How to pick up more work as a private hire driver

If you work as a private hire driver, you will already know that competition in the industry is fierce. Of course, a lot of this comes down to the location you provide your services in. Nevertheless, it is important to do everything you can to stand out from the crowd if you are to secure more business. With that being said, let’s take a look at some of the ways you can pick up more work as a private hire driver.

Consider working for Uber

One of the best ways to pick up more job opportunities is to work for Uber. Uber is one of the fastest growing companies ever. You can expect a large number of jobs to come through, and you can work hours that suit you. However, don’t forget to get Uber taxi insurance if you do go down this route. Uber driver insurance will ensure you are covered against public liability insurance and road risks. Uber insurance is essentially private hire taxi insurance as standard motor insurance isn’t suitable.

Market yourself better

You need to get to grips with the world of online marketing if you are to pick up more work. There are numerous platforms you can make the most of, from having your own website to using social media. Remember, people turn to the Internet because it is convenient, so if you can offer useful features like an online booking system, you’re going to reap the rewards. You will also need to get to grips with search engine optimisation so that your information will feature near the top of the search engine result pages.

Consider going niche

Another way to pick up more work is to embrace niche markets and to invest in target marketing. For example, you could establish yourself as a dedicated airport hire service, or at least target this segment of the market in your next campaign. Or, you could target students by offering discounts if they show you their student card? Nowadays, it can really pay to concentrate on certain portions of the market, rather than trying to cater to everyone.

If you follow the three tips that have been mentioned above, you should notice some improvements with regards to the amount of work you pick up. From joining Uber to improving your social media efforts, there are many ways to make your business stand out.
